Good morning everyone! I am a member of a reenactment association and we have our web space with Nextcloud installed. This Nextcloud instance serves both as a base where we put everything we need for our researches, and as a space to keep and share those researches. We basically have pdf files (books, articles, researches) and images (miniatures from manuscripts, photos of frescoes, statues and so on). Although using Nextcloud with “general” files is great, I am looking for a way to keep and organize images. By now we have a folder-subfolder organization system, which sucks because a single image might have more than one notable item in it…for example, if I have a miniature showing knights fighting, it may have some interesting swords that fit in Weapons->Swords->One-handed swords, but also a helmet that fits into Armour->Helmets->Closed-face helmets. Also, we usually catalogue those images with relevant data, for example a title, the date, the manuscript they are taken from, and provenance. Putting those informations on filename is quite inefficient.

So, basically, what I’m looking for is a way to add a caption with relevant data to the images, and put tags (every user should be able to do that) and search through them. I took a look ad Nextcloud Photos and also at Memories, they are photos-oriented and only show image exif data (whis is not useful in my case), and ite use of collaborative tags is not intuitive (one has to open the side panel, then click on the menu and chose “Show tags”). My idea is something similar to this site: https://manuscriptminiatures.com/
If possible, I would also try to customize Photos or Memories to show only a caption and tags…but, if possible, I would avoid third part services since I fear it would add complexity to my other group members…
